Organising Collection on PC
I am finally at the stage where I can have my whole collection on my PC but how do I organise it? Already I am finding that I am forgetting what music I have so it would be nice to narrow it down within certain parameters. Do I make individual alphabetised folders? Make genre folders? (this then leads to sounding a twat when you have 6 zillion genres on your PC). How do you organise it or maybe you like chaos? I have to be tidy and methodical!

I just do a folder for each band & another for sessions & compilations

So all albums by one band stay in one folder?
|
Yes. Also, I have a separate folder for new music which I've downloaded recently. It helps me remember to listen to it and decide if I want to keep it.

If I want a bands discography to be in order I just add the year before the title. Or if they made more than one album in a year just add stuff like 1977.1 1977.2 and so on & so on. Although I don't usually bother with that. and like Addidass all my new stuff goes in one folder till it's been heard. Then it get's filed on the HD if I like it enough. |

I have far too much music to realistically dump all the artists in one folder, so I sort by genre and subgenre. All the album names are preceded by the release year and I have all albums of a band in one folder. I chuck my recently acquired albums in an excel spreadsheet for the benefit of my flatmates but it's also good as a to-listen list.
